Subject: [PATCH v3 15/22] dyndbg: add support for hex_dump output to trace

Add support for writing hex_dump debug logs to trace.

Signed-off-by: Łukasz Bartosik <lb@semihalf.com>
Signed-off-by: Jim Cromie <jim.cromie@gmail.com>
---
 include/linux/dynamic_debug.h | 16 ++++++++++------
 lib/dynamic_debug.c           | 36 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
 2 files changed, 46 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

diff --git a/include/linux/dynamic_debug.h b/include/linux/dynamic_debug.h
index dc10c7535f13..76eec3f05be9 100644
--- a/include/linux/dynamic_debug.h
+++ b/include/linux/dynamic_debug.h
@@ -298,12 +298,16 @@ void __dynamic_ibdev_dbg(struct _ddebug *descriptor,
 	_dynamic_func_call(fmt, __dynamic_ibdev_dbg,		\
 			   dev, fmt, ##__VA_ARGS__)
 
-#define dynamic_hex_dump(prefix_str, prefix_type, rowsize,		\
-			 groupsize, buf, len, ascii)			\
-	_dynamic_func_call_no_desc(__builtin_constant_p(prefix_str) ? prefix_str : "hexdump", \
-				   print_hex_dump,			\
-				   KERN_DEBUG, prefix_str, prefix_type,	\
-				   rowsize, groupsize, buf, len, ascii)
+void _print_hex_dump(struct _ddebug *descriptor, const char *level,
+		     const char *prefix_str, int prefix_type, int rowsize,
+		     int groupsize, const void *buf, size_t len, bool ascii);
+
+#define dynamic_hex_dump(prefix_str, prefix_type, rowsize,				\
+			 groupsize, buf, len, ascii)					\
+	_dynamic_func_call(__builtin_constant_p(prefix_str) ? prefix_str : "hexdump",	\
+			   _print_hex_dump,						\
+			   KERN_DEBUG, prefix_str, prefix_type,				\
+			   rowsize, groupsize, buf, len, ascii)
 
 /* for test only, generally expect drm.debug style macro wrappers */
 #define __pr_debug_cls(cls, fmt, ...) do {			\
diff --git a/lib/dynamic_debug.c b/lib/dynamic_debug.c
index c382ea5dea19..65dafdec7b76 100644
--- a/lib/dynamic_debug.c
+++ b/lib/dynamic_debug.c
@@ -1355,6 +1355,42 @@ static void ddebug_dev_printk(struct _ddebug *desc, const struct device *dev,
 	}
 }
 
+void _print_hex_dump(struct _ddebug *descriptor, const char *level,
+		     const char *prefix_str, int prefix_type, int rowsize,
+		     int groupsize, const void *buf, size_t len, bool ascii)
+{
+	const u8 *ptr = buf;
+	int i, linelen, remaining = len;
+	unsigned char linebuf[32 * 3 + 2 + 32 + 1];
+
+	if (rowsize != 16 && rowsize != 32)
+		rowsize = 16;
+
+	for (i = 0; i < len; i += rowsize) {
+		linelen = min(remaining, rowsize);
+		remaining -= rowsize;
+
+		hex_dump_to_buffer(ptr + i, linelen, rowsize, groupsize,
+				   linebuf, sizeof(linebuf), ascii);
+
+		switch (prefix_type) {
+		case DUMP_PREFIX_ADDRESS:
+			ddebug_printk(descriptor, KERN_DEBUG "%s%s%p: %s\n",
+				      level, prefix_str, ptr + i, linebuf);
+			break;
+		case DUMP_PREFIX_OFFSET:
+			ddebug_printk(descriptor, KERN_DEBUG "%s%s%.8x: %s\n",
+				      level, prefix_str, i, linebuf);
+			break;
+		default:
+			ddebug_printk(descriptor, KERN_DEBUG "%s%s%s\n",
+				      level, prefix_str, linebuf);
+			break;
+		}
+	}
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(_print_hex_dump);
+
 void __dynamic_pr_debug(struct _ddebug *descriptor, const char *fmt, ...)
 {
 	va_list args;
